The Andersons HumiChar Organic Soil Amendment combines 30% humic acid and 43% biochar in a patented Dispersible Granule form, enabling rapid nutrient delivery and deep soil penetration without tilling. OMRI-listed and eco-friendly, this 40 lb formula enhances soil health, reduces fertilizer needs, and supports sustainable, long-term plant vitality.

Southern Sandy Soil Cure
If you live in the South and deal with sandy soil, I want to share something that truly changed my lawn: biochar. It’s not just hype—it works.When we bought our home, our soil was bleeding out nutrients and water faster than I could put them in. I ran soil tests and realized I was throwing money away on fertilizers that couldn’t stick. That’s when I started digging into real solutions—and that’s how I found biochar.Now, I apply it twice a year with the goal of reaching 200 pounds over the next few seasons on our front lawn. It’s an investment—$600 to $800 total—but here’s the thing: biochar lasts 100 years or more in the soil. It locks in nutrients, holds water, and transforms how your soil works.By the time my plan is complete, we’ll likely cut our irrigation needs by 40% and reduce fertilizer use by half—so it ends up paying for itself if you’re willing to be patient and consistent.Here’s what I’ve learned:• Charge the biochar with organic fertilizers—they feed the microbes and bring the biochar to life.• Add micronutrients and macronutrients when applying—it’s like seasoning the soil properly.• Stick with it. Every application improves CEC (cation exchange capacity) and builds the kind of soil plants thrive in.If you’re not sure how much to use, you can use tools like GPT (yes, the AI!) to calculate the right amount based on your lawn’s square footage and your soil goals. If your soil is sandy and struggling, this is one of the most powerful long-term changes you can make.Take your time. Stay consistent. Step 1 for a lush lawn
This is long, BUT READ THIS before wasting your money on other products.I've been attempting to fix my turf since 2021, when I moved into my new home. I initially hired a lawn service, but the success was short-lived.Last fall, I took matters into my own hands by dethatching, scarifying, and overseeding. After minimal success with germination (I took all the steps to protect the seeds and keep them moist), my lawn came up thin and light green in the spring. Despite heavy rains, my soil was still hard as a rock. My soil pH was high, so I bought Mag-I-Cal to lower the pH. I also bought Love Your Soil to loosen the hard clay. Those also had short-lived success. I knew my soil was the problem. The pH came down slightly, but the soil remained compact. I realized that years of fertilizer and over-irrigation by the previous owners had probably built a carbon deficiency and sodium chloride concentration. I read up on this product. It's everything you need to condition your soil on a more permanent basis. The charred component makes space for healthy microbes and the humic component feeds the microbes.I used fungicide to treat lawn disease this season, but as this product layers into the soil and improves water retention at greater depths with healthier root structures, I've had fewer indications of disease. I also have fewer urine burn spots from my dogs. The soil pH has neutralized as the soil retains more rain water (which is slightly acidic in my area).I treat my lawn with this every 2-3 weeks at a light/moderate rate with plans to continue to do so as it moves deeper into the soil.Start with your soil. Treat it heavily for 1 season before scaling back to maintenance applications. Cut your grass high and help the roots grow deep. Healthy turd is resilient and needs less care. I'll swear by this product and won't switch to Humic DG or PGF Complete for humic content until my soil is fully amended.This product is worth the money.
